LevittownNow.com

The latest news from the Levittown, Pa. area.

LevittownNow.com is a locally-owned news outlet that covers the communities of Bristol Borough, Bristol Township, Falls Township, Hulmeville Borough, Langhorne Borough, Langhorne Manor Borough, Penndel Borough, Middletown Township, and Tullytown Borough in Bucks County, Pennsylvania. We have been providing local news from a team of trusted journalists since March 13, 2013.
